Aeroflot airline has changed the requirements for carry-on luggage carried on board, the Travel.ru portal reported, citing the carrier’s statement on Facebook. From the list of items carried in addition to hand luggage, the carrier excluded cell phones, laptops, cameras, video cameras, umbrellas, paper folders and printed publications. These items will be included in the total weight of hand luggage: for economy class 10 kg, for business class - 15 kg.

According to the new rules, a passenger can also bring on board no more than one sealed bag from Duty Free shops (with dimensions in the sum of three dimensions no more than 115 cm). A backpack carried with hand luggage and still not limited in size must not weigh more than 5 kg and exceed 80 cm in the sum of three dimensions. Without additional payment, as well as size and weight restrictions, you can only carry a briefcase or handbag, outerwear, a suit in a briefcase and a bouquet of flowers. You can also bring it on board at no extra charge. baby food and devices for carrying a child weighing no more than 7 kg and dimensions no more than 42x50x20 cm, medicines, crutches, canes, walkers, rollators, a folding wheelchair. When transporting a musical instrument in hand luggage, a passenger will be able to carry additional items free of charge only that are specified in the list of excess hand luggage.

When checking in or at the boarding gate, passengers will have to present hand luggage for weighing, as well as a backpack, baby cradle, or baby stroller when transporting a child.

Aeroflot emphasized that a special control system for hand luggage was introduced due to increasing complaints from passengers about the lack of space to accommodate it in the aircraft cabin.

Changes to hand luggage rules were widely discussed in 2017. The low-cost carrier Pobeda was the most active advocate for updating the rules. The carrier has repeatedly found itself at the center of litigation with passengers due to its own interpretations of air legislation, in particular those related to the size of the “backpack,” which were not specified anywhere.

At the end of July, the Federation Council, despite a barrage of criticism, approved a bill submitted by the government and passed through the State Duma repealing the norm free transportation luggage for non-refundable air tickets. The amendments retained in the Air Code (AC) for return tickets the right to check in baggage of at least 10 kg, but a non-refundable fare “may not include” the checked baggage allowance. The carrier is also obliged to inform the passenger about the conditions for the carriage of baggage and hand luggage when purchasing a ticket.

At the same time, the Ministry of Transport presented its draft regulatory act on carry-on luggage standards, explaining the VK norm. The ministry proposed setting a minimum luggage weight of 5 kg, and outerwear, an umbrella, a cane, a laptop, a mobile phone, a camera and a video camera were excluded from the list of things that can be taken on board for free.

Since December, Pobeda has prohibited passengers from taking into the aircraft cabin any items that exceed the size of the airline’s free hand luggage limit of 36x30x27 cm, as well as free hand luggage and items the carriage of which is permitted by law.

Baggage size and weight

Based on the sum of 3 dimensions, the size of checked baggage at Aeroflot should not exceed 158 cm, and the weight of the baggage depends on the class of ticket taken :

  • Business class - 2 seats no more than 32 kg each
  • Comfort class - 2 seats no more than 23 kg each
  • Economy class (Premium group) - 2 seats no more than 23 kg each
  • Economy class - 1 seat no more than 23 kg

If the total weight of luggage (including hand luggage) does not exceed 10 kg, then Aeroflot does not limit the number of pieces of luggage.

Weapons and ammunition

The first thing a person transporting a weapon must have with them is permission to store and carry this weapon. Secondly, when booking and checking in for a flight, you need to inform that you are carrying weapons. Weapons and ammunition permitted for carriage in baggage may consist of one piece of baggage with one weapon (or one container specially designed for the carriage of weapons with several weapons belonging to one passenger) and one piece of baggage with ammunition. Such weapons and ammunition are not regarded as a separate place, they go together with your belongings, the main thing is that they do not generally exceed the established free norm (specified above in the article). If it exceeds, you will have to pay for excess baggage. Weapons and ammunition are prohibited from being transported in the same baggage (container). And the gross weight of ammunition cannot exceed 5 kg.

Musical instruments

Aeroflot allows the transportation of musical instruments both in checked luggage and hand luggage. When transported in a passenger seat, the weight of the tool should not exceed 80 kg, dimensions should not exceed 135x50x30 cm. When transported in the luggage compartment, the weight of the tool should not exceed 50 kg. Prior approval with the airline is required no later than 36 hours before the scheduled flight departure time.

Animal in luggage

Aeroflot does not allow pets to be transported for free (the only exception is for a guide dog for a visually impaired person and a dog from the canine service of federal executive authorities; these dogs are allowed in the aircraft cabin). You will have to pay for the rest of the animals. Payment for an animal is charged as for a second piece of luggage; now Aeroflot charges 2,500 rubles if you are flying within Russia or 50 conventional units (euros or dollars), depending on where you are flying abroad. If the animal and its cage exceed the permissible size (weight and size no more than 50 kg), you will need to pay extra as for excess baggage. I repeat, when purchasing a ticket, agree with the carrier that you want to take an animal. Transportation of an animal or bird is possible only by an adult passenger. Everything must be with you Required documents for the transported animal.

The website says who cannot be carried as baggage:

  1. rodents (guinea pigs, rats, chinchillas, chipmunks, squirrels, gerbils, dormice, marmots, gophers, jerboas, etc.);
  2. reptiles (turtles, iguanas, geckos, chameleons, snakes, lizards, frogs, etc.);
  3. arthropods;
  4. animals and birds that are not domesticated;
  5. sick and experimental animals.

Indoor domesticated animals such as cats, dogs, birds are accepted for transportation. Other animals, such as ferrets, ferrets, meerkats, fennec foxes, lorises, hedgehogs, mini-rabbits, marmosets and others, are accepted for transportation if they are domesticated pets.

Caution for carrying Samsung Galaxy Note 7 smartphones on board

Back on September 15, 2016, Aeroflot airline announced the news that owners of Samsung Galaxy Note 7 smartphones should carry them only in hand luggage, and under no circumstances in luggage. Several incidents of fire and explosion of this smartphone occurred around the world, and Samsung in October of the same year recalled all phones and offered to replace them with another model. In this regard, large Russian airlines, including Aeroflot, expressed their warnings regarding the transportation of this model:

  • Turn off your phone on board an airplane
  • Do not charge it during the entire flight

Aeroflot hand luggage, dimensions and weight 2018

Aeroflot has again updated its hand luggage restrictions, making them more flexible. Currently, the carrier’s website states that the dimensions of one piece of hand luggage for all classes of service should not exceed: 55 cm in length, 40 cm in width, 25 cm in height. Weight Limit hand luggage is 10 and 15 kg depending on the class of service.

On February 12, the carrier issued a press release stating that from February 15, Aeroflot will strictly monitor passengers’ compliance with carry-on baggage standards. At the same time, it was reported that the airline had reduced permissible size bags that can be accepted as hand luggage, up to dimensions 55 x 40 x 20 cm (length, width, height).

This framework does not include many suitcases purchased by passengers specifically for carry-on luggage. In fact, the airline applied the norms of foreign low-cost carriers, asking passengers to pay extra for excess baggage.

Hand luggage standards for Russian airlines

S7 Airlines allows you to carry 1 piece of hand luggage in the cabin measuring 115 cm (55 x 40 x 20 cm) and weighing 10-15 kg, depending on the class of service.

U " Ural Airlines» The dimensions of one piece of hand luggage for all classes of service and fares are no more than 55 x 40 x 20 cm. The weight of hand luggage and the number of pieces depends on the class of service (1-2 pieces from 5 to 15 kg).

UTair allows you to take items weighing up to 10 kg and the sum of three dimensions up to 115 cm (55 × 40 × 20) in hand luggage; you can carry one piece. In the Comfort and Business fare plans, two pieces of hand luggage are allowed.

The carry-on baggage allowance for the low-cost Pobeda airline is limited to dimensions of 36 x 30 x 27 cm.

Carry-on luggage on an airplane dimensions and weight. Hyou can take it with you to the plane cabin

5 kg is the minimum weight of hand luggage that a passenger can take on the plane for free. Until 2018, the weight of hand luggage was not specified in any laws or regulations; everything was left to the airlines. On the other hand, not a single Russian carrier has a norm of less than 5 kg (even Pobeda literally ten days ago included 5 kg in its rules). More - as much as you like. Aeroflot, for example, has 10 kg. The order does not prohibit airlines from maintaining more generous rates. And, of course, 5 kg must comply with the norms aviation security(that is, liquids - in containers up to 100 ml).

Mobile phones, cameras, laptops and other gadgets, as well as umbrellas and books, were excluded from the list of things that can be taken into the cabin for free EXCEEDING the carry-on baggage allowance. Argument of the Ministry of Transport: they can be put away in a handbag, briefcase or backpack. With a mobile phone - no problem, you can put it in your pocket, and it’s lightweight and won’t create an advantage. But a professional camera or laptop taken together may well do so. You can't put equipment in your luggage.

New baggage rules, Pobeda

On Pobeda Airlines LLC flights, the following restrictions apply to the carriage of Hand Luggage:

overall dimensions no more than 36 x 30 x 27 centimeters,

total weight no more than 5 kilograms.

If you are not sure that your Carry-on Baggage meets the required dimensions, place it in the mechanical Carry-on Baggage meters with the airline logo installed at the airport. Carry-on baggage must be measured before entering the passenger screening area. The Carry-on Baggage allowance applies to each Passenger separately and does not apply to children under 2 years of age who are carried free of charge.
